The McDermott (Cadet) Library provides collegiate and professional-level reference, research and reading collections that support the academic and mission needs of the Academy. The Clark Special Collections, located on the 6th floor of the Library, houses a wealth of historical materials related to manned flight, air warfare, falconry, and the U.S. Air Force.

This library is a congressionally designated depository for U.S. Government documents. Public access to the government documents collection is guaranteed by public law (Title 44 United States Code).
